Paris’s 124-year-previous Metro program poses the largest obstacle. Despite the substantial financial commitment in infrastructure created since 2017, when town received its Olympic bid, only twenty five p.c with the rail network that travels to central Paris — such as the Metro, express rail and trams — is accessible to those with disabilities. And only one Metro line, its latest, is thoroughly accessible to individuals who use wheelchairs.

The minimal fare is €7.thirty, whether or not the meter exhibits considerably less. motorists detest doing brief rides, so get in and shut the door right before telling them in which you’re likely. 

Taxis in Paris are metered, which means that their fares are calculated by their taximeter according to the journey’s distance and time (exempt for airport transfers to Paris downtown, which have established costs).
